City open to Mangala sale?

Manchester City could cash in on the services of Eliaquim Mangala in the current transfer window. The Frenchman has struggled to adapt to the Citizens' play since his move from Porto in 2014.



The 25-year-old was heavily criticised for his poor showing in the league last season, and this has urged the club's hierarchy to consider his position

According to The Sun, Mangala's time could be up at the Etihad with manager Pep Guardiola willing to integrate Jason Denayer into the first-team.

The Mancunian giants are also nearing a move for Everton's John Stones, and his arrival is likely to dent Mangala's chances of earning any playing time next season.

La Liga side Valencia have expressed interest in recruiting the central defender, who has racked 64 appearances for City till date.
